okay, well as far as I know "credit points" dont exist, you can have a "credit rating" but you dont get credit points

OpenStudy (anonymous):

Its unlikely businesses, will give you discount just for paying what you owe them, so i would discount B too

OpenStudy (anonymous):

Banks are going to lend money to someone who is trustworthy. someone with good credit has been proven to borrow money and pay it back in a timely manner. So i would select option C
